Problem with Supermicro home lab server, ESXi won't install as server always reboots

While trying to build up a home lab (I think it's often being referred to as a "whitebox" system?) I don't get the ESXi installation up and running. Since three days I haven't been able to install ESXi.

 

Problem:

The ESXi 5.5U3 installation fails and immediately restarts the host before it starts actually doing anything ... specific.

 

Using IPMI of my mainboard I have recorded (and also attached) a video and tried to embed it here:

In case you don't see it please look at the attached file.

 

For those who can't see it the hosts starts up and begins extracting the files to the memory. When it switches to the grey-yellow screen it shows the following lines and then - BOOM - reboots the host and it starts all over again:

 

Initializing timing ...

Initializing scheduler ...

Initializing power management ...

user loaded successfully.

REBOOT

 

I have tried several options like booting over USB, both internally and externally, change between USB 2.0 or 3.0 ports, or IPMI ISO loading but nothing, it all fails with the same problem or even f*cks up my video output when attaching a KVM Storage ISO file. Also disabling legacy USB support didn't solve anything and even had to reset the BIOS afterwards. Also to make sure it's not RAM-related I have switched the memory and tried it with 8 or with 16 GB or full 32 GB and also tried different banks, no change.

 

This is the hardware I'm using:

 

  • Supermicro X10SLL-F
  • Kingston 32GB ECC 240-Pin UDUMM Kit (4 x 8 GB)
  • be quiet 400W power supply
  • SATA HDD 250 GB (or without)
  • Lexar 8 GB USB Stick (formatted with Rufus) / no-name 4 GB USB Stick

 

As described above nothing I've tried did fix anything and I'm starting to feel helpless for a.) not being able to continue and b.) having spent a lot of money on things that currently don't work (and I'd rather not send things back).

I know that currently this mainboard is not listed itself but factually have seen several blog posts of people who use this mainboard successfully. Why am I the only one who can't do it?

 

Oh any by the way, the ESXi version is this: VMware-VMvisor-Installer-5.5.0.update03-3116895.x86_64.iso
